The Rise of Cryptocurrency in the USA

                 

The Rise of Cryptocurrency in America

                                        












Cryptocurrency, particularly Bitcoin, burst onto the scene in 2009, and since then, it has gained widespread popularity and acceptance. In the United States, the adoption of cryptocurrencies has been driven by several factors, including technological advancements, regulatory developments, and increasing interest from both retail and institutional investors.

Technological Advancements

One of the primary drivers of cryptocurrency adoption in the USA is technological innovation. Blockchain technology, which underpins most cryptocurrencies, has proven to be a secure and efficient way to record transactions. This technology has found applications beyond digital currencies, including supply chain management, voting systems, and decentralized finance (DeFi).

Regulatory Developments

The regulatory environment for cryptocurrencies in the USA has evolved significantly over the past decade. Initially, there was a lack of clarity regarding the legal status of digital currencies, leading to uncertainty among investors. However, in recent years, federal and state governments have made strides in providing clearer guidelines and regulations.

For instance, the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) has taken steps to classify certain cryptocurrencies as securities, subjecting them to federal securities laws. Additionally, the Internal Revenue Service (IRS) has issued guidelines on the tax treatment of cryptocurrencies, providing much-needed clarity for taxpayers.

Increasing Interest from Investors

The interest in cryptocurrencies has grown exponentially among both retail and institutional investors. Retail investors are drawn to the potential for high returns and the decentralized nature of digital currencies, while institutional investors see cryptocurrencies as a hedge against inflation and economic uncertainty.

In 2024, we can expect this trend to continue, with more investors entering the cryptocurrency market and increasing the overall market capitalization.

Technological Advancements and Innovation

Technological advancements will continue to play a pivotal role in the future of cryptocurrency. In 2024, we can expect significant innovations in blockchain technology, making it more scalable, efficient, and secure.

One of the key areas of innovation is the development of Ethereum 2.0, which aims to address the scalability and energy consumption issues associated with the current Ethereum network. Ethereum 2.0 will transition from a proof-of-work (PoW) to a proof-of-stake (PoS) consensus mechanism, reducing the environmental impact of mining and increasing transaction speeds.

Decentralized Finance (DeFi) and Smart Contracts

Decentralized Finance (DeFi) is another trend that will shape the future of cryptocurrency in the USA. DeFi platforms use smart contracts to offer financial services such as lending, borrowing, and trading without the need for traditional intermediaries like banks.

In 2024, we can expect the DeFi ecosystem to grow and mature, offering more sophisticated and user-friendly services. The increased adoption of DeFi will provide individuals with greater control over their financial assets and promote financial inclusion.

Environmental Concerns and Sustainable Solutions

Environmental concerns related to the energy consumption of cryptocurrency mining have been a topic of debate. In 2024, we can anticipate a greater focus on sustainable solutions and the development of eco-friendly mining practices.

Several cryptocurrency projects are already exploring ways to reduce their carbon footprint, such as utilizing renewable energy sources and implementing energy-efficient consensus mechanisms. As environmental awareness grows, the cryptocurrency industry will likely prioritize sustainability in its operations.
